About J. M. Day

J. M. Day is a scholar working on Agronomy and Crop Science, Plant Science, Soil Science, Ecology, Evolution, Behavior and Systematics and Catalysis, having authored 35 papers that have together received 990 indexed citations. Recurring topics across this work include Legume Nitrogen Fixing Symbiosis (24 papers), Agronomic Practices and Intercropping Systems (16 papers), Agricultural pest management studies (6 papers), Botanical Research and Chemistry (4 papers), Plant nutrient uptake and metabolism (3 papers), Plant Micronutrient Interactions and Effects (3 papers), Soil Carbon and Nitrogen Dynamics (3 papers) and Agricultural Science and Fertilization (3 papers). The work is most often cited by research in Agronomy and Crop Science (280 citations), Plant Science (793 citations), Soil Science (185 citations), Horticulture (4 citations) and Ecology, Evolution, Behavior and Systematics (75 citations). J. M. Day has collaborated with scholars based in United States, United Kingdom and India. Frequent co-authors include Johanna Döbereiner, P. J. Dart, A. R. J. Eaglesham, R. J. Roughley, K.E. Giller, P. A. Huxley, F. R. Minchin, R. J. Summerfield, J. F. Witty and S P Wani. Their work appears in journals such as The Journal of Agricultural Science, Experimental Agriculture, Plant and Soil, Annals of Applied Biology and Soil Biology and Biochemistry.
